Story

Limits of Control follows a mysterious stranger who works outside the law and keeps his objectives hidden. Throughout the film, he embarks on a journey across Spain, navigating through his own consciousness. His demeanor is paradoxically focused yet dreamlike.

Summary

Directed by Jim Jarmusch in 2009, Limits of Control is a unique blend of drama, mystery, and thriller genres that takes place in Spain. The film centers around a mysterious stranger who operates outside the law, trusting no one. While the plot details are intentionally sparse to maintain an air of mystery, the stranger's journey serves as both a physical odyssey across Spain and an exploration into his own consciousness.
